数据家,idc官网,算力,裸金属,高电机房,边缘算力,云网合一,北京机房,北京云计算,北京边缘计算,北京裸金属服务器,北京数据服务器,北京GPU服务器,高算力服务器,数据机房相关技术新闻最新报道
计算机集群是一种通过将多个计算机组合在一起工作,以实现更强大的计算能力和可靠性的架构。通过将计算任务分配给集群中的多台计算机并进行并行计算,可以加速处理速度,提高系统的容错性和可扩展性。
计算机集群通常可以按照不同的方式进行分类,主要包括:
高可用性集群旨在提供高度可靠的服务,防止单点故障和系统停机时间。它通常由多个节点组成,当其中一个节点出现故障时,其他节点可以接管服务并继续正常运行,从而确保系统的连续可用性。
负载均衡集群通过将流量均匀地分配给集群中的各个节点,以实现更好的性能和可扩展性。它可以根据服务器的负载情况,动态地调整请求的分发,从而实现各个节点的负载均衡,提高系统的整体处理能力。
数据共享集群通过将数据存储在集群中的多个节点上,并使其能够同时访问,以实现数据的高可用性和容错性。它可以通过数据复制和同步技术来确保数据的一致性,提高系统的可靠性和可恢复性。
数据分析集群是一种通过将大规模的数据分割成小块,并在集群中的多个节点上进行并行处理,以加快数据分析速度的架构。它通常使用分布式计算框架(如Hadoop)来实现数据的分布式存储和并行计算,提供高性能的数据分析能力。
搭建计算机集群需要经过以下步骤:
首先需要选择适合的硬件设备,包括服务器、网络设备和存储设备。服务器应具备足够的计算能力和存储容量,网络设备应支持高速和可靠的数据传输,存储设备应具备高可用性和容错性。
在每台服务器上安装和配置操作系统。根据实际需求选择合适的操作系统,如Linux或Windows Server,并进行基本的网络和安全设置。
设置集群中各台服务器之间的网络连接,确保它们可以相互通信和协作。配置IP地址、子网掩码、网关等网络参数,并进行网络测试和故障排除。
安装和配置集群管理软件,如Hadoop、Kubernetes、Docker等。根据实际需求选择合适的软件,并根据软件的安装指南进行详细的配置和测试。
根据实际需求和性能要求,调整和配置集群的各项参数,如内存分配、并行计算线程数、数据分片大小等。通过进行性能测试和调优,优化集群的整体性能和吞吐量。
将需要运行在集群上的应用程序部署到集群中。根据应用程序的要求,进行相应的配置和优化,确保它们可以高效地运行在集群上,并进行系统测试和监控。
运行和管理集群,监控系统的运行情况,及时处理故障和异常。定期进行系统维护和优化,提高集群的性能和可靠性。
根据业务需求和系统负载情况,逐步扩展集群的规模和容量。进行必要的硬件和软件升级,保持集群始终处于最佳状态。
通过以上步骤的搭建,您可以构建一个高性能、可靠的计算机集群架构,满足大规模计算和数据处理的需求。